This search query appears to be a specific "Google Dork" used to locate potentially unauthorized movie files hosted on Google Drive. Based on the terms used, the searcher is likely looking for a Spanish-dubbed version of The Hangover Part II (known as ¿Qué pasó ayer? Parte II in Latin America) or possibly the movie . Analysis of Search Terms
site:drive.google.com: This operator restricts results exclusively to files and folders hosted on the Google Drive platform. avatar: References James Cameron's franchise. que paso ayer 2: This is the Spanish title for The Hangover Part II
español: Specifies that the user is looking for content dubbed or subtitled in Spanish. Intent & Risks
The combination of these terms suggests an attempt to bypass official streaming platforms to find "open" directories. However, using these types of links carries significant risks:
Malware: Files labeled as popular movies on public drives are frequently used to distribute viruses or ransomware. Soluciones Si experimentaste este error ayer, aquí te
Broken Links: Google frequently removes files that violate copyright policies, meaning these links are often dead or lead to phishing sites.
Copyright Infringement: Accessing or distributing copyrighted material through these channels violates Google's Terms of Service. Official Viewing Options
